Money from Sainsbury family will enable upgrades to building’s envelope and environmental systems
Norman Foster’s Grade II* listed Sainsbury Centre is set for a comprehensive refurbishment after a £91.2m donation from a charity linked to the Sainsbury family.
The art museum, located at the University of East Anglia (UEA) campus in Norwich, was built in 1977 and is today recognised as a landmark achievement of the British High-Tech architectural movement.
